1. Letter to Employer Requesting Information About Wages Earned By
Beneficiary20 CFR 404.1520, 404.1571404.1576, 404.1584404.1593, and 416.971416.97609600034.
Social Security disability recipients receive payments based on their inability to engage in substantial gainful activity SGA because of a physical or mental condition. If the recipients work, SSA must evaluate if they continue to meet the disability requirements of the law. When an individual is unable to provide earnings information and SSA
does not have access to proof of earnings, we use Form SSAL725 to
request monthly earnings information from the recipients employer. SSA
employees send the paper from SSA
L725 to the employer to complete, and use the earnings data we receive from the employers to determine whether the recipient is engaging in SGA, since work above SGA level can cause a cessation of disability payments. The respondents are businesses that employ Social Security disability recipients.
Type of Request: Revision of an OMBapproved information collection.

2. Request for Review of Hearing Decision/Order20 CFR 404.967
404.981, 416.1467416.14810960
0277. Claimants have a right under current regulations to request review of a judges hearing decision, or dismissal of a hearing request on Title II and Title XVI claims. Claimants may request Appeals Council review by filing a written request using paper Form HA
